Missouri Revised Statutes § 1.016 - Secondary sources do not constitute law or public policy, when
Secondary sources do not count as Missouri law or public policy when adopting them would change rights, remedies, or causes of action, or when they conflict with or are not covered by Missouri statutes or appellate precedent.
